Preschool vs. Staying Home: What’s the Difference?

It’s completely natural for parents to wonder about preschool vs. staying home, especially if they have the ability to keep their child home during the early years. At first glance, home can seem just as stimulating: you can read books, play games, and spend time together every day.

But the biggest difference between staying home and attending preschool is structure. A well-designed preschool program offers experiences, peer interactions, and routines that are difficult to replicate consistently at home.

Here’s what makes that structure so valuable:

  • Academic exposure: Children engage daily with pre-literacy, early math, and hands-on science through guided play and teacher-led activities.

  • Peer learning: Kids learn how to share, take turns, and solve problems alongside classmates.

  • Classroom routines: Following instructions, managing transitions, and building independence prepare children for kindergarten expectations.

  • Trained educators: Certified teachers know how to nurture curiosity and meet each child at their own developmental level.

At home, many parents do their best to introduce educational activities, but few can consistently provide the same mix of group learning, structured routines, and social development that a professional program offers.


The Academic Payoff: Laying a Strong Foundation

Parents often ask, “Is preschool worth it? academically?” The answer is a resounding yes — especially when it’s a program designed for whole-child development.

At Kids Kingdom Early Learning Center, our curriculum for ages 3 to 6 is built around early literacy, math, science, and critical thinking skills that prepare students for kindergarten and beyond.

Early Literacy and Language

Our classrooms are rich with conversation, storytelling, and books. Children learn to recognize letters, connect sounds, and express ideas clearly through activities that feel like play. This exposure gives them a major advantage when they begin formal reading instruction in kindergarten.

Early Math and Problem-Solving

Counting, measuring, sorting, and pattern recognition are part of daily routines. Through fun, hands-on games, children build logical reasoning and early numeracy skills that create confidence in later math learning.

Science and Curiosity

Our young learners explore nature, experiment with simple cause-and-effect lessons, and make predictions — all of which develop observation skills and curiosity about the world.

Kindergarten Readiness Skills

Perhaps most importantly, our program focuses on the learning habits that make kindergarten smooth and enjoyable: following directions, focusing during group activities, and developing persistence when a task feels challenging.

A strong start in these areas doesn’t just make kindergarten easier: it helps students feel confident and capable from day one.


Social and Emotional Growth: The Hidden Advantage

While academics are important, social development is just as critical at this age. In fact, studies consistently show that children who attend preschool have better emotional regulation, social confidence, and conflict-resolution skills than those who don’t.

At Kids Kingdom, children learn these essential skills naturally through guided play and faith-based values.

Learning to Share and Cooperate

Working with classmates on activities teaches patience, empathy, and respect for others. Our teachers model kind communication and help children practice problem-solving when disagreements arise.

Building Confidence and Independence

Preschool provides a safe environment for children to make choices, take responsibility for small tasks, and experience the satisfaction of success. Each achievement, whether putting away materials or mastering a new skill, builds self-esteem.

Developing Emotional Awareness

Our teachers help children recognize and name emotions, an essential step toward self-control and empathy. These lessons carry over into every part of life, helping children handle transitions and challenges with resilience.

For parents comparing preschool vs. staying home, these daily social experiences are one of the biggest benefits of enrolling in a structured early learning program.


Movement and Physical Development Matter Too

Academic success doesn’t come from sitting still all day. In fact, physical movement plays a huge role in brain development, focus, and emotional balance. That’s why Kids Kingdom Early Learning Center incorporates at least 60 minutes of large-muscle activity into every school day.

Whether it’s running, climbing, dancing, or outdoor play, these activities help children:

  • Strengthen coordination and balance.

  • Develop focus and self-regulation.

  • Build confidence through teamwork and active play.

By giving children a chance to move, explore, and release energy, we help them return to the classroom ready to concentrate and learn.

The Long-Term Benefits of Preschool

The advantages of preschool extend far beyond kindergarten. Studies show that children who attend high-quality preschool programs are more likely to:

  • Perform better on reading and math assessments.

  • Develop stronger attention spans and problem-solving skills.

  • Show fewer behavioral issues and greater emotional maturity.

  • Maintain positive attitudes toward school throughout their education.

Simply put, preschool helps children see learning as fun, not stressful…and that’s a mindset that lasts a lifetime.

Preschool Character Development: A Holistic Vision in Greenwood

When we think about education, it’s easy to focus on the ABCs and 123s. But seasoned educators and parents know that character is just as critical—if not more so—than academic prowess. That’s why preschool character development in Greenwood preschools, especially those with biblical values, takes center stage. These schools prioritize virtues like honesty, obedience, sharing, perseverance, and self-control, not merely as behavioral goals but as reflections of biblical teachings.

Imagine a classroom where conflict resolution is guided by principles from Proverbs, where stories about Jesus’ compassion inform how children treat one another, and where daily routines like cleanup time become lessons in stewardship and responsibility. In these classrooms, character is not a side subject—it’s the curriculum itself. Through structured activities, imaginative play, and real-time social experiences, children internalize values that prepare them to navigate future challenges with moral clarity and emotional intelligence.

What sets biblically-based programs apart is the intentionality behind this development. Instructors don’t just correct misbehavior; they explain why a certain action aligns—or doesn’t—with what God desires for us. Over time, this shapes a child’s conscience, providing an internal compass that guides decision-making far beyond the preschool years.
